- PMO Development & Governance: Support the Head of PMO in establishing and enhancing the Portfolio Management Office, ensuring governance, control, and standardisation across the portfolio.
- Planning & Resource Management: Lead strategic and operational planning, from 3-5 year roadmaps to individual resource plans, ensuring effective allocation and forecasting.
- Strategic Alignment & Value Realisation: Ensure the portfolio aligns with business objectives, embedding value and benefit realisation frameworks to measure success.
- Process Improvement & Change Management: Develop and embed change management processes, driving continuous improvement to enhance efficiency and effectiveness.
- Stakeholder & Supplier Management: Build strong relationships with senior stakeholders, suppliers, and external vendors to ensure PMO services meet business needs.
- Data Analytics & Reporting: Utilise data analytics to provide insights into portfolio performance and develop reports and dashboards for key stakeholders.
- Risk, Issue & Quality Assurance: Lead risk, issue, and dependency management, ensuring quality assurance processes maintain high delivery standards.
- Training & Community Support: Provide coaching, training, and SME support to the Portfolio Delivery Community and PMO team, fostering a centre of excellence.
- Financial & Vendor Oversight: Oversee financial management within the portfolio, ensuring cost control while managing relationships with key suppliers and external partners.
